Understanding Door Locks


Before diving into the specifics of replacement locks, let's take a look at the various types of door locks currently offered:

  1. Deadbolts: Known for their robust security, deadbolts need a key or thumb turn to lock and open, making them perfect for exterior doors.
  2. Knob Locks: These are commonly discovered on residential doors. While convenient, they are less secure than deadbolts.
  3. Lever Handle Locks: Ideal for interior doors, these locks are simpler to run than knob locks.
  4. Smart Locks: Offering state-of-the-art functions such as keyless entry and remote gain access to by means of smart device apps, smart locks are ending up being increasingly popular.
  5. Mortise Locks: These use a higher level of security and are frequently utilized in commercial centers.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)


1. How often should I replace my door locks?

Normally, it's recommended to change your door locks every 5 to 7 years, or sooner if you observe wear or if your secrets have actually been lost or taken.

2. Can I change a lock myself?

Yes, lots of locks can easily be replaced with standard tools. Nevertheless, it's advisable to seek advice from the installation guide and guarantee you have the required abilities for secure installation.

3. What is the best type of lock for home security?

Deadbolts are often thought about the best alternative for home security, particularly when integrated with a smart lock for added convenience.

4. Are smart locks secure?

Smart locks can be secure provided they are from reputable brand names and used with strong passwords, two-factor authentication, and regular updates.

5. What should I do if my lock is jammed?

If your lock is jammed, prevent using excessive force. Rather, try lubricating it with graphite or a silicone-based lube. If the problem continues, consider calling a locksmith.
